Question
Fill in the blanks:
The Governors-General during the First and Second Anglo-Maratha Wars were _____________ and ____________, respectively.
Advertisements
Solution
The Governors-General during the First and Second Anglo-Maratha Wars were Warren Hastings and Lord Wellesley, respectively.
